RE: Thermal analysis, structural analysis
1. Build your thermal model, solve.
2. Build your structural model.
3. NWRITE the nodes from your structural model to a file (e.g. "structural_model.node")
4. Interpolate your thermal model results onto your structural model nodes with BFINT (e.g. "thermal_loads.bfin")
5. Read your interpolated temperatures into your thermal model (e.g. "/input,thermal_loads,bfin")
Let me know if I've forgotten anything, but I think that's pretty much it.
